Crippled Black Phoenix was formed in 2004 by Justin Greaves as an ever-evolving musical project driven by emotional inquiry and moral tension. Across two decades, the project has built a singular catalogue rooted in human fragility, endurance, and resistance to complacency.

Sceaduhelm represents the project’s most inward-looking and austere statements to date. Written and recorded between 2023 and 2025, the album turns away from grand historical narratives to examine emotional erosion, fatigue, and quiet collapse. Rather than a traditional concept record, it unfolds as a unified psychological space, where repetition, restraint, and unease carry as much weight as melody. The songwriting favours slow builds and unresolved tension, resisting catharsis in favour of endurance. Vocals are shared between Belinda Kordic, Ryan Patterson, and Justin Storms, each offering a distinct but complementary perspective within the same emotional terrain. Themes of burnout, memory, violence against the vulnerable, and love already worn thin surface without spectacle. Produced by Justin Greaves and mixed by Iver Sandøy, the sound remains deliberately raw and exposed, avoiding comfort or excess. Sceaduhelm listens closely to what remains after outrage has faded, focusing on consequence rather than reaction.
